<p><strong>What Is Automated Fertigation?</strong></p>



<p>Automated fertigation integrates <strong>mechanical, electronic, and digital systems</strong> to manage the timing, composition, and flow of fertilizers in irrigation water. In essence, it’s an intelligent system that makes decisions for the farmer — guided by soil, crop, and weather data.</p>



<p>An automated fertigation system typically includes:</p>



<ul class="wp-block-list">
<li><strong>Fertilizer injectors or dosing pumps</strong> that control the amount of nutrients added to irrigation water.</li>



<li><strong>Sensors</strong> that monitor parameters like pH, electrical conductivity (EC), soil moisture, and nutrient concentration.</li>



<li><strong>Controllers and software</strong> that regulate dosing schedules and nutrient ratios.</li>



<li><strong>Connectivity tools (IoT, GSM, or Wi-Fi)</strong> that allow remote monitoring and control via smartphones or computers.</li>
</ul>



<p>Automation ensures that nutrient delivery is synchronized with plant demand and environmental conditions, replacing guesswork with precision.</p>



<p><strong>How Automation Works in Fertigation</strong></p>



<ol class="wp-block-list">
<li><strong>Data Collection:</strong><br>Sensors collect continuous data on soil moisture, pH, EC, and sometimes nutrient concentrations (like nitrate or potassium). Weather data (temperature, humidity, rainfall forecasts) is also integrated.</li>



<li><strong>Decision-Making:</strong><br>A central control unit or software analyzes the data using algorithms that calculate the nutrient requirement based on crop growth stages and field conditions.</li>



<li><strong>Automated Dosing:</strong><br>Fertilizer injectors precisely mix and inject soluble fertilizers into the irrigation system according to the calculated schedule.</li>



<li><strong>Feedback and Correction:</strong><br>Real-time feedback from sensors ensures the system adjusts immediately if EC, pH, or moisture levels deviate from optimal thresholds.</li>
</ol>



<p>This closed-loop automation ensures <strong>perfect nutrient balance</strong> with minimal waste.</p>



<p><strong>Advantages of Automated Fertigation</strong></p>



<p><strong>1. Precision and Consistency</strong></p>



<p>Automated systems maintain consistent nutrient levels, unaffected by human error or timing issues. Nutrient delivery becomes uniform across the field, improving overall crop performance.</p>



<p><strong>2. Labor and Time Efficiency</strong></p>



<p>Automation drastically reduces manual monitoring and intervention. Once configured, the system handles irrigation and fertilization with minimal supervision — freeing up farmers to focus on other critical operations.</p>



<p><strong>3. Enhanced Nutrient Use Efficiency (NUE)</strong></p>



<p>By controlling the concentration and timing of fertilizer application, automated fertigation ensures nutrients are used efficiently, reducing losses through leaching or runoff.</p>



<p><strong>4. Resource Optimization</strong></p>



<p>Water and fertilizers are applied only when and where needed, resulting in savings of up to 40–50% in water and 25–35% in fertilizer use.</p>



<p><strong>5. Sustainability and Environmental Protection</strong></p>



<p>Precise control minimizes nutrient discharge into water bodies and reduces greenhouse gas emissions from over-fertilization — promoting sustainable farming.</p>



<p><strong>Applications Across Crops and Systems</strong></p>



<p>Automated fertigation has shown exceptional results in:</p>



<ul class="wp-block-list">
<li><strong>Horticultural crops</strong> like tomato, capsicum, banana, grapes, and cucumber.</li>



<li><strong>Greenhouse and polyhouse farming</strong>, where environmental conditions are tightly controlled.</li>



<li><strong>High-value field crops</strong> such as cotton and sugarcane in regions adopting precision irrigation.</li>
</ul>



<p>For example, in <strong>grape cultivation in Maharashtra</strong>, automated fertigation systems have improved fruit quality and yield consistency while cutting fertilizer use by nearly 30%. Similarly, in <strong>Israeli and Spanish greenhouse systems</strong>, automation has become the backbone of climate-smart agriculture.</p>



<p><strong>Technology Drivers behind Automation</strong></p>



<ul class="wp-block-list">
<li><strong>IoT and Cloud Integration:</strong> Enables real-time monitoring and control from anywhere.</li>



<li><strong>AI Algorithms:</strong> Predict crop needs and adjust fertigation accordingly.</li>



<li><strong>Nutrient Sensors:</strong> Detect real-time nutrient concentration in soil or irrigation water.</li>



<li><strong>Mobile Apps and Dashboards:</strong> Offer user-friendly interfaces for farmers.</li>



<li><strong>Machine Learning Models:</strong> Continuously improve nutrient scheduling accuracy.</li>
</ul>



<p>Automation is the bridge between digital agriculture and traditional wisdom — merging decades of farming experience with the power of modern technology.</p>



<hr class="wp-block-separator has-alpha-channel-opacity"/>



<p><strong>Challenges in Adoption</strong></p>



<ul class="wp-block-list">
<li><strong>Initial Investment:</strong> The cost of sensors, controllers, and automated pumps can be high for smallholders.</li>



<li><strong>Technical Skills:</strong> Farmers need training to manage and maintain systems.</li>



<li><strong>Infrastructure Requirements:</strong> Reliable power and internet connectivity are essential for real-time operation.</li>
</ul>



<p>However, government subsidies and private agri-tech companies are making automation more accessible, offering modular systems that can be scaled according to farm size and budget.</p>
